下面是测试主函数:
#include <iostream>
#include "MyStack.h"
#include "Coordinate.h"
using namespace std;
int main() {
MyStack<Coordinate> *pStack = new MyStack<Coordinate>(5);
pStack->push(Coordinate(3, 5));//坐标点入栈
pStack->push(Coordinate(7, 5));
pStack->push(Coordinate(6, 5));
pStack->push(Coordinate(4, 5));
pStack->push(Coordinate(3, 5));
pStack->stackTranverse();//遍历栈
Coordinate t;
pStack->pop(t);//出栈
cout <<"弹出的t为:"<< t ;
cout << "长度:" << pStack->stackLength();
pStack->clearStack();//清空栈
pStack->stackTranverse();
//delete pStack;
//pStack = NULL;
system("pause");
return 0;
}
以上就是本文的全部内容,希望对大家的学习有所帮助,也希望大家多多支持ASPKU。
注:相关教程知识阅读请移步到C++教程频道。










